## Onboarding — Markdown Pipeline (Inkmere)

Inkmere docs render through a three-stage pipeline: parse, sanitize, emit. Releases rebuild all templates; never hot-patch emitted HTML. Broken renders usually mean a sanitizer rule change — check the rules diff first. The render cluster only accepts builds from the release channel, and every build artifact must be signed before upload. Sign artifacts with the deploy key below.

release key, hafop-tajef: bky13_s2vaFVNJTHfBL

**Ticket: Config drift in event schema registry**

New folks: the Larkfield schema registry (service name `skeinreg`) has drifted between staging and prod. Staging accepts backward-incompatible schema changes; prod rejects them. That mismatch caused last week's failed promotion of the order events. Fix is to align compatibility mode and subject naming in both environments, then re-run the conformance job. Do not hand-edit prod. The intended canonical configuration is below.

service settings:
[casax]
port = 6379
team = rusir
host = casax.zemvarhq.corp
region = outer-4
access_code = ac_9808ce
timeout_ms = 1500

Vendor note, weekly sync: Hollis & Grange partner SFTP drop moved to their new Tidemark host Monday. Old host stops accepting keys Friday. Our pull job updated; theirs is not — files may land twice until Thursday. Dedupe is on our side, no action. Any missing-file reports this week go straight to their transfer desk at the address below.

escalation mailbox, badug-tawip: ulaath@nelvroforge.example

Welcome to the Gatecount team. Our service tallies turnstile entries at Ashmere Stadium and feeds live occupancy numbers to the Corlan safety dashboard. Counts must never be estimated — if a turnstile node drops offline, the reconciliation job backfills from its local buffer. That buffer is encrypted at rest, and restoring it requires an unseal step. When the restore tool prompts, enter the passphrase below.

unlock words, tawif-tahop: oliys-ulawyn-tamdor-lamys-casox-jormir-fraius-kasath-ulador-ulamir-holir-sorys-holeth